Southampton faced one of their worst Premier League seasons, with only two wins and a total of 12 points, leading to the earliest relegation in the league's history. In light of this poor performance, the club has decided to undergo a significant reset by appointing 32-year-old Will Still as their new manager. Still, who has managed teams in Belgium and France, arrives with a strong reputation despite concerns about his experience. His primary task will be to rejuvenate the club after their relegation and prepare for the Championship season.
